Preparing Your Figma File for a Flawless Handoff

Before you even think about converting your design, optimizing your Figma file is a non-negotiable first step. A clean design file is the foundation for clean code and a smooth Figma to WordPress project.

Organize and Name Your Layers

A developer shouldn’t need a map to navigate your design. Use a logical, hierarchical structure for your layers and frames. Group related elements (e.g., “Header,” “CTA Button,” “Footer-Column-1”) and name them clearly. This dramatically speeds up development and reduces errors.

Leverage Auto Layout and Components

Use Figma’s Auto Layout feature extensively. This helps define the responsive behavior of your components, showing the developer exactly how elements should reflow on different screen sizes.

Furthermore, using components for repeatable elements like buttons and cards ensures consistency and makes it clear which items should be turned into reusable code modules in the final WordPress build.

Create a Comprehensive Style Guide

Don’t make the developer guess your design tokens. Your file should include a clear style guide page detailing:

  • Typography: Font families, sizes, weights, and line heights for all headings (H1-H6) and body copy.
  • Color Palette: All primary, secondary, and accent colors with their HEX/RGB codes.
  • Grid and Spacing: Define your grid system and standard spacing units (e.g., 8px, 16px, 24px).
  • Iconography: A library of all icons used, preferably in SVG format for a crisp look after the Figma to WordPress conversion.

Method 1: Manual WordPress Development (The Gold Standard)

For ultimate quality, control, and performance, nothing beats custom manual development. This process involves a skilled developer writing a bespoke WordPress theme from scratch based on your Figma designs, ensuring a perfect Figma to WordPress result.

This is the approach we take at Twenyone for our clients. See how our Figma to WordPress services can deliver a superior product tailored to your business goals.

The Process

  1. Asset Export: The developer exports all necessary assets (images, SVGs) from your prepared Figma file.
  2. Theme Scaffolding: The developer creates a new WordPress theme with the necessary files (style.css, index.php, functions.php).
  3. HTML/CSS Development: The developer translates the Figma design into static HTML and CSS, ensuring pixel-perfect accuracy.
  4. PHP/WordPress Integration: The static templates are broken into WordPress template files and integrated with WordPress functions to make the site dynamic.

Pros and Cons

  • Pros: Unmatched quality, clean code, SEO-optimized, highly scalable, and completely custom.
  • Cons: Highest cost, longest timeline, requires expert developer.

Method 2: Page Builders & Figma Importer Plugins

For those with limited coding knowledge, WordPress page builders like Elementor or Divi, combined with Figma importer plugins, offer a middle ground. These tools aim to automate parts of the Figma to WordPress workflow.

Popular Plugin Examples

Plugins often act as a bridge, converting Figma elements into the page builder’s format. While convenient, this comes at the cost of code quality and performance. Be cautious of tools promising a one-click solution, as they rarely deliver a professional Figma to WordPress website.

Evaluating the Trade-Offs

This method can suit simple landing pages. However, for a business website, the resulting bloated code can negatively impact loading speeds—a fact highlighted by SEO authorities like Moz in their page speed guides. The reliance on multiple plugins also increases security vulnerabilities.

Method 3: Automated Conversion Tools & Services

A new breed of AI-powered tools promises to convert your Figma design into code automatically. These services analyze your design and generate HTML/CSS or even basic WordPress theme files.

How They Work

You typically upload your Figma file or provide a link, and the platform’s AI interprets the layers and styles to produce code. While impressive, the output often lacks the semantic structure and optimization of human-written code, making it a poor choice for a serious Figma to WordPress project.

The Hidden Costs of Automation

The code generated is often generic and not optimized for performance or accessibility, key tenets championed by organizations like the W3C. Fixing these issues can sometimes take more time than building the site correctly from the start.

Method 4: Building a Hybrid Theme with Block Editor

This advanced method leverages the native WordPress Block Editor (Gutenberg). Developers create custom blocks that correspond directly to the components in your Figma design. It’s a modern approach to the Figma to WordPress challenge.

The Power of Custom Blocks

Imagine your Figma component library perfectly mirrored in the WordPress backend. Your marketing team can build complex, beautifully designed pages without writing code or breaking the design. Can you directly import Figma to WordPress?

No, there is no native one-click “import” function. While some third-party plugins and tools claim to automate this, they do not produce the high-quality, optimized code of a professional development process. The best methods always involve a developer to ensure a quality Figma to WordPress result.

What is the most reliable way to convert Figma to WordPress?

Without question, manual development of a custom theme by an experienced WordPress developer or agency is the most reliable method. This approach to Figma to WordPress guarantees clean code, optimal performance, perfect design fidelity, and future scalability, representing the gold standard.

How much does a Figma to WordPress conversion cost in 2026?

The cost varies dramatically based on the method. Automated tools can be under $100, while a professional agency conversion for a complex site can range from $5,000 to $25,000+. The final price of a Figma to WordPress project depends on the design’s complexity and required functionality.

How long does it take to convert a Figma design to a WordPress website?

The timeline depends on the chosen method and project complexity. A simple landing page using a plugin might take a few days. A full, custom-coded site can take anywhere from 3 to 8 weeks for a thorough, professional Figma to WordPress process that includes development, testing, and revisions.

Do I need to know code to convert my design?

To achieve a high-quality result, yes, coding knowledge (HTML, CSS, PHP, JavaScript) is essential. If you are not a developer, using page builder plugins is an option for simple projects, but for a professional outcome from your Figma to WordPress design, you must hire a developer or agency.
